[159.2.239.150]) by smtp.gmail.com with ESMTPSA id af79cd13be357-93b7821d231sm483562385a.21.2026.09.17.07.48.05 (version=TLS1_3 cipher=TLS_AES_256_GCM_SHA384 bits=256/256); Thu, 17 Sep 2026 07:48:05 -0700 (PDT) Received: from jgg by wakko with local (Exim 4.97) (envelope-from ) id 1x7DPA-0000000Ctlh-2V45; Thu, 17 Sep 2026 11:48:04 -0300 Date: Thu, 17 Sep 2026 11:48:04 -0300 From: Jason Gunthorpe To: Peng Fan , Krzysztof Kozlowski Cc: Will Deacon , Robin Murphy , "Joerg Roedel (AMD)" , Jean-Philippe Brucker , linux-arm-kernel@lists.infradead.org, iommu@lists.linux.dev, linux-kernel@vger.kernel.org, Peng Fan Subject: Re: [PATCH RFC 0/4] iommu/arm-smmu-v3: Support shared Stream IDs Message-ID: <20260917144804.GI3196566@ziepe.ca> References: <20260916-smmu-shared-sid-v1-0-517384504aee@nxp.com> <20260916161018.GE3196566@ziepe.ca> Precedence: bulk X-Mailing-List: linux-kernel@vger.kernel.org List-Id: List-Subscribe: List-Unsubscribe: MIME-Version: 1.0 Content-Type: text/plain; charset=us-ascii Content-Disposition: inline In-Reply-To: On Thu, Sep 17, 2026 at 09:33:55AM +0800, Peng Fan wrote: > Hi Jason, > > On Wed, Sep 16, 2026 at 01:10:18PM -0300, Jason Gunthorpe wrote: > >On Wed, Sep 16, 2026 at 11:12:33PM +0800, Peng Fan (OSS) wrote: > >> Some SoCs have a limited number of IOMMU Stream IDs (SIDs) and > >> hardware that inherently shares them. For example, the NXP i.MX95 > >> eDMA controller has 64 channels where each TX/RX pair is assigned > >> a single SID by the hardware - the two channel devices are distinct > >> from Linux's perspective but present the same SID to the SMMU. > > > >Is that a reflection of poor DT modelling though? > > > >Why must a TX/RX *PAIR* have two platform_devices nodes? > > > >Fix it there and you don't need any of this? Or is there more? > > I think there may be a misunderstanding about the device topology here. > > There is only one platform device node for the eDMA controller > (dma-controller@42000000). There are no separate platform device nodes per > channel pair. > > What happens instead: > The fsl-edma driver probes the single platform device. During > dmaenginem_async_device_register(), the dmaengine core calls Yes, and if your DT is correct then that platform device should have a single iommus = [] listing all the SIDs for that logical device. Using iommu-map to describe synthetic dma_chan_dev devices that the kernel creates is the same kind of DT abuse from over here: https://lore.kernel.org/linux-iommu/20260618151745.GD231643@ziepe.ca/ So the problem is self created, by using iommu-map instead of iommus and using DT to describe linux SW expectations you end up in this strange place of asking for aliases. > The iommu-map property sits on the eDMA controller's DT node. At channel > allocation time (xlate), the driver calls of_dma_configure_id(chan_dev, > edma_np, true, &chan_id) to look up the channel index in the eDMA node's > iommu-map and attach an IOMMU domain to that specific channel device. The > dmaengine framework's dmaengine_get_dma_device() API > (which checks chan->dev->chan_dma_dev) then returns the per-channel device > instead of the parent platform device, so DMA clients map buffers through > the correct IOMMU context. So go back to the basics, why did this platform use iommu-map instead of iommus? The only real difference is you get a DMA translation per queue. Is that required? Are you short IOVA? Some other reason? You can read what I wrote about this general problem before: https://lore.kernel.org/linux-iommu/20260818130724.GA5482@ziepe.ca/ It would be really nice if you all could work together to figure out a better way to handle this than through DT abuses. If you really need unique translations per sub-compoment of a logical device from some pool of SIDs that feels like a weird version of PASID to me, it may be an interesting to explore. Jason
